An auditor conducting an audit shall comply with all of the following:
(1)The contract under which the audit is performed must provide
a description of audit procedures that will be followed.
(2)For an onsite audit conducted at a pharmacy's location, the
auditor that conducts the audit shall provide written notice to the
pharmacy at least two (2) weeks before the initial onsite audit is
performed for each audit cycle.
(3)The auditor shall not interfere with the delivery of pharmacist
services to a patient and shall use every effort to minimize
inconvenience and disruption to pharmacy operations during the
audit. This subdivision does not prohibit audits during normal
business hours of the pharmacy.
